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

0.482 x 61.2^2 ÷ √98.01

61.2^2 = 3745.44

√98.01 = 9.9

So,

0.482 × 3745.44 ÷ 9.9

= 1,805.30208 ÷ 9.9

= 182.35374545454

To one significant figure

= 200

One significant figure means only 1 non zero value and others are zero

The approximation to 1 significant figure of the result is 200
